Power Circuit

​​In this group workout, we remove a part of the cardio program to add strength training exercises. It’s 60-minutes of circuit-training intensity and one of the most efficient hour-long workouts. During Power Circuit, you’ll enjoy 30-minutes of our “circuit,” which involves High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) and cardio. You’ll also get in 30-minutes of strength training, giving your body the ultimate full body workout. We change our circuit every week to keep it fresh.

Power Circuit is similar to our Power Hour class. It’s just a bit more intense and replaces the rower with the circuit, making it a great alternative if you’re not a fan of rowing. With Power Circuit, you’ll burn a ton of calories while improving your metabolism and cardiovascular fitness.

Benefits of HIIT

There are countless reasons we incorporate HIIT into our Power Circuit class. First and foremost, it’s efficient. Research proves you can achieve more in a short HIIT workout than a long cardio session. HIIT is also a safe and effective way to burn more fat, build a healthier heart, and promote weight loss without muscle loss. In addition, it may increase your metabolism and instantly boost your mood. What do I need for Power Circuit?

A pair of tennis shoes, comfortable workout clothes, water, and a sweat towel. Water and sweat towels are available for purchase.
